DFEB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2022 in Review

80 of the 5,936 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in FT Vest US Equity Deep Buffer ETF February (DFEB) for Q2 2022, worth a combined $160M — down 13% from $183M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 10 funds closed out of DFEB and 6 opened new positions — a net loss of 4 holders — while 38 trimmed existing stakes and 15 added.

The largest buyer was Ogorek Anthony Joseph, adding an estimated $2.26M. The largest seller was ERn Financial LLC, exiting entirely with an estimated $3.2M sold.
